In the direction of that conclusion, the initial and also in some ways only rule of telescopes is:

Aperture is actually Master!

Aperture is the dimension of the main lense or even mirror of the telescope. The much bigger it is, the even more light the telescope collects. Do certainly not determine a telescope by its zoom, and also avoid coming from any brand name of telescope that markets on its own on excess magnification insurance claims (300x!, 600x!, and so on). This makes certain sign of poor quality.

Much more light gathering means better, brighter graphics, presuming all other points being actually identical. Suitable commercially sold telescopes commonly start concerning 60mm in size (about 2.3") as well as head to 20" dimension or more. Around speaking, every 2 extra ins of aperture multiplies the light gathering capability of the telescope, Discover more.

The big concern along with obtaining more aperture is that it improves the measurements as well as weight of the telescope. Possessing a huge, big telescope along with bunches of lightweight celebration power possesses little bit of benefit if it is actually thus hefty you certainly never want to take it out as well as use it! A minor, however important warning to the 'Eye is King' regulation is actually that the tiny, mobile telescope that obtains used continuously is actually a lot more strong than the large telescope that never gets vacated the garage.

What Kind of Telescope?

There are 3 kinds of telescope: Reflector, Refractor, and also Cassegrain. For beginners functions, only the first two must be seriously considered. Cassegrain telescope are actually extremely pleasant, however are actually a little innovative for first time extent shoppers.

Reflector: telescopes use parabolic or circular curved represents to gather and also Reflector Telescopeconcentrate lighting. The advantage of reflector telescopes is that they are actually the best economical for bigger dimensions. The disadvantages are: in inverted graphic (suggesting a reflector telescope can not be actually used for looking down the street) and a need for occasional maintenance: the mirror needs to sometimes be aligned, or even parallelled to ensure the telescope is working at its own ideal.

Refractor: telescopes use pair of or even even more lenses to flex as well as acquire (or even refract) illumination. The Refractor Telescopeadvantage for refractors is that, at equal dimensions, they provide an additional crisp photo of the item being viewpoint versus a reflector telescope, refractors likewise could be used for terrestrial viewing (i.e. Overlooking the street once more), and they perform certainly not need to have to be parallelled like reflector telescopes. The drawbacks to refractor telescopes is actually that as refractor telescopes receive larger, they improve in rate at a much faster cost than reflectors. At much smaller dimensions, claim 2-3" in diameter, the prices are actually roughly identical for reflectors and also refractors. Through the time you reach a 5" aperture, the cost of the refractor will certainly be actually at minimum double that of the reflector.

Because of the difficulty of grinding much larger lenses, the weight of those lenses, as well as a visual impact phoned colorful aberration (where the illumination is split as it takes a trip by means of the refractors lens in a way identical to prisms) refractors typically are actually certainly not made larger than 5-6" in size.

What Sort of Mount?

Any sort of telescope is actually visiting need a position! There are three unique position styles to look at: altazimuth, equatorial, as well as dobsonian. Whatever place you pick, it ought to be powerful good enough to keep the optical pipe without wobbling. Absolutely nothing is actually extra annoying than making an effort to view an object in the sky, merely to possess it bounce about and be unwatchable because of a bad position.

Altazimuth Places: Altazimuth installs are basic positions designed to help strive the Altazimuth Positioned Telescopetelescope in straightforward up/down (height) and also left/right (azimuth). Altazimuth installs are easy as well as intuitive, and function effectively for beginners. They are likewise valuable if you prefer to use your telescope for earthlike watching. The problem along with altazimuth positions is this: items in the sky carry out stagnate in beneficial up/down, left/right activity. They relocate with the sky in an arc (or at least it seems to be by doing this to us!). This suggests that attempting to track celestial objects utilizing an altazimuth position could be like attracting a curve along with an etch-a-sketch! For many novice looking at, this is not an issue, and one can regularly reacquire an item that vacates the field of vision. However it does suggest that if you find a nice object along with your telescope, and delegate go allow your good friends recognize, it will likely move out of the eyepiece perspective due to the opportunity you return!

Equatorial Mounts: Often called German equatorial positions, are actually set apart through Equatorially Mounted Telescopetheir counterweights that are actually needed to keep the telescope correctly harmonized. Equatorial installs need even more create than altazimuth positions as they should be gotten used to your latitude and intended North. They are additionally not as user-friendly to strive as altazimuth mounts as they carry out not comply with left/right up/down movements yet as an alternative declination and best rising. This observes the pathway of superstars, planets, as well as deep space objects, however takes some receiving used to. The perks of equatorial positions are actually that they can track items with a turn of an opener, or they can even be motorized. The other perk is that along with some study, the equatorial position's setting groups could be used to in fact find items in the evening heavens! Equatorial places are additionally required for any sort of form of astrophotography, but for novices this need to not be a wonderful problem.

Dobsonian Mounts: Some take into consideration the Dobsonian to be merely variant of the altazimuth Dobsonian Telescopemount, and they are not fully wrong. Dobsonians possess the very same advantages and disadvantages of altazimuth positions: intuitive movement, no tracking, etc. But the difference is actually that a Dobsonian mount makes use of a lazy-susan style platform to move in azimuth and often some kind of hubs to transfer elevation. The outcome is actually that a Dobsonian mount can manage considerably, a lot bigger optical pipes than many altazimuth tripod positions are capable of managing.
